Cory Demmel is a dynamic and engaging leader who's an expert at growing leaders as a keynote speaker, coach, consultant, and the lead pastor at Cape Christian! Paul Faronbi and Cory Demmel explore the multifaceted nature of leadership, emphasizing the importance of vulnerability, self-awareness, and connection. Cory shares his personal journey, insights on creating a healthy organizational culture, and the critical role of feedback in leadership development. The discussion highlights how embracing one's humanity and fostering teamwork can lead to greater success and fulfillment in both personal and professional realms. They explore the importance of feedback, the value of embracing one's uniqueness in leadership, and the profound impact of encouragement. They share personal anecdotes that highlight how meaningful connections and experiences shape their leadership journeys. The discussion also delves into the significance of continuous learning and the catalysts that drive personal and professional growth. In this conversation, Cory Demmel and Paul Faronbi explore the nuances of leadership, emphasizing the importance of trust, execution, and self-awareness. They discuss the challenges of navigating an information-rich environment, the significance of micro habits in achieving personal goals, and the value of adding purpose to everyday interactions. Cory shares his core principles for success, advocating for a focus on execution and the cultivation of self-awareness as essential components of effective leadership.
